Автор Тема: Альт Линукс 7.0 Кентавр как сервер виртуальных машин  (Прочитано 3090 раз)

Оффлайн kon-dv

  • Участник
  • *
  • Сообщений: 724
    • Заметки учителя
Всем доброго времени суток.
Посоветуйте, пожалуйста, можно ли использовать Альт Линукс 7.0 Кентавр как сервер виртуальных машин и если можно то как? Какое ПО используется, раздел меню и т.д.
Морфиус на меня обиделся...

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 20 159
    • Домашняя страница
Всем доброго времени суток.
Посоветуйте, пожалуйста, можно ли использовать Альт Линукс 7.0 Кентавр как сервер виртуальных машин и если можно то как? Какое ПО используется, раздел меню и т.д.
Можно. Читайте про VirtualBox (есть в меню), KVM (virt-manager в меню) и OpenVZ. Можно ещё дополнительно почитать про Xen и LXC, но работа с ними требует более высокой квалификации.
Андрей Черепанов (cas@)

Оффлайн kon-dv

  • Участник
  • *
  • Сообщений: 724
    • Заметки учителя
Цитировать
KVM (virt-manager в меню)
По умолчанию он уже установлен?
В панели управления он есть?
Хотелось бы управлять виртуальными машинами при помощи веб интерфейса
Морфиус на меня обиделся...

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 20 159
    • Домашняя страница
Цитировать
KVM (virt-manager в меню)
По умолчанию он уже установлен?
По умолчанию virt-manager не ставится в профиле сервера. Можно выбрать группу или установить самому.
Цитировать
В панели управления он есть?
Хотелось бы управлять виртуальными машинами при помощи веб интерфейса
alterator-mkve нынче неработоспособен. Так что из консоли или через гуёвый virt-manager (локальный или удалённый).
Андрей Черепанов (cas@)

Оффлайн Rider

  • /usr/sbin/control
  • *******
  • Сообщений: 1 136
Я libvirt пользуюсь, вполне себе сервер виртуальных машин.

Оффлайн grumbler

  • alt linux team
  • ***
  • Сообщений: 126
Я успешно использую libvirt и kvm. Есть одна тонкость: чтобы виртуальные машины не "тормозили", необходимо, во-первых, включить все опции виртуализации в BIOS, и во-вторых, использовать виртуальные устройства с драйверами virtio. Документация по настройке имеется и в wiki.altlinux.ru, и на других ресурсах, никаких особенностей у дистрибутива altlinux нет.

Также я пробовал использовать XEN, но в "Кентавре" он неработоспособен.

Если нужны виртуалки только с Linux, наверняка удобнее будет OpenVZ. Но я запускаю в виртуальных машинах и *nix, и Win*.

Оффлайн PSV

  • Участник
  • *
  • Сообщений: 361
Я успешно использую libvirt и kvm. Есть одна тонкость: чтобы виртуальные машины не "тормозили", необходимо, во-первых, включить все опции виртуализации в BIOS, и во-вторых, использовать виртуальные устройства с драйверами virtio. Документация по настройке имеется и в wiki.altlinux.ru, и на других ресурсах, никаких особенностей у дистрибутива altlinux нет.

Также я пробовал использовать XEN, но в "Кентавре" он неработоспособен.

Если нужны виртуалки только с Linux, наверняка удобнее будет OpenVZ. Но я запускаю в виртуальных машинах и *nix, и Win*.
А можно с этого места поподробнее? Где именно про НАСТРОЙКИ virtio на альтах?
У меня:
[root@lgaten ~]# zcat /proc/config.gz | grep VIRTIO
CONFIG_NET_9P_VIRTIO=m
CONFIG_VIRTIO_BLK=m
CONFIG_SCSI_VIRTIO=m
CONFIG_VIRTIO_NET=m
CONFIG_VIRTIO_CONSOLE=m
CONFIG_HW_RANDOM_VIRTIO=m
CONFIG_VIRTIO=m
CONFIG_VIRTIO_PCI=m
CONFIG_VIRTIO_BALLOON=m
CONFIG_VIRTIO_MMIO=m
CONFIG_VIRTIO_MMIO_CMDLINE_DEVICES=y
Почему везде m, а не y? Или это как раз нормально? На другом компе так же и все бегает на ура.
Посоветуйте, куда рыть в поисках проблемы.
Ситуация следующая: нулевый комп: i5-3450 + asus P8B75-m + alt p7(х64 с сайта + все обновы) + в BIOS включил INTEL virtualization.
[root@lgaten ~]# egrep -q '^flags.*(vmx|svm)' /proc/cpuinfo && echo yes
yes
Делаю все как обычно, уже не первый раз, но:
1. запускаю уже настроеную гостевую машину(alt р7): мышки нет.
2. создаю новую гостевую(альт р7), пытаюсь установить там р7, не работает мышка. Если щелкнул внутри окна гостевой, то мышка там и остается, для освобождения контрол+шифт.
3. не показывает графики параметров гостевой машины.
Все тоже самое, но на i3 работает со свистом. Куда копать? Может для вирт сервака надо какие-то дрова доставить?

Оффлайн PSV

  • Участник
  • *
  • Сообщений: 361
Кстати, запустил сейчас там же winXP из существующего образа, мышка работает нормально.
Ничего не понимаю :(

Оффлайн PSV

  • Участник
  • *
  • Сообщений: 361
i5-3450 + asus P8B75-m + alt p7(х64 с сайта + все обновы) + в BIOS включил INTEL virtualization
uname -r
3.10.32-std-def-alt1
Используется freenx server+kde trinity для доступа к virt-manager.

Зря я грешил на железо. Похоже в qemu+virt-manager, после последних обновлений, где-то проблема.
Причем появилась она с последними обновлениями. Т.к. на боевом сервере, до обновлений, все работало как надо.
1. Обозначено красным. поехали куда-то значки. Не критично.
2. Обозначено желтым. Пропали графики производительности. Очень желательная инфа. На старом серваке показывает.
3. Обозначено синим. Неправильные статусы гостевых машин. А вот это уже конкретный косяк. Лечится только перезапуском virt-manager.
4. Не работает мышь в гостевой altlinux. Т.е. создаю новую гостевую, монтирую диск для установки, установка стартует, а мышка не работает. Если взять win дистрибутив, то там с мышкой проблем нет.

Предполагаю, что 2 и 3 косяка одни ноги. Возможно пакет какой-то надо до установить. Или дрова неправильно встали.
С 4 тоже можно пережить. Но разбивку диска делать очень неудобно с помощь клавы.
Куда посоветуете глянуть? Как-то можно определить, что дрова в системе встали ровно?

Оффлайн rits

  • Участник
  • *
  • Сообщений: 1 233
  • ITS
Мышь при запуске виртуальной машины через virt-manager не работает в окне виртуальной машины, а через kvm -параметры /образ.qcow2, мышь работает. Где подкрутить параметры автозахвата мыши в окне виртуальной машины?

Оффлайн rits

  • Участник
  • *
  • Сообщений: 1 233
  • ITS
Мышь при запуске виртуальной машины через virt-manager не работает в окне виртуальной машины, а через kvm -параметры /образ.qcow2, мышь работает. Где подкрутить параметры автозахвата мыши в окне виртуальной машины?

Нашел! В панели конфигурации оборудования была добавлена мышь: тип - PS/2, режим - относительное движение. Решение: добавил еще одну мышь, тип - Стандартная USB мышь, режим - относительное движение.